1. Realigning Sliding Doors
Tools Needed: Screwdriver, level

Actions:
Check Level: Use a level to figure out if the door frame is plumb.Change the Rollers: Locate the adjustment screws on the door's rollers, generally discovered at the bottom. Turn the screws to raise or lower the door.Test the Door: Slide the door backward and forward to look for correct alignment.2. Replacing a Broken Lock
Tools Needed: Screwdriver, replacement lock

Steps:
Remove the Old Lock: Unscrew the latch mechanism from the door.Set Up the New Lock: Follow the maker's instructions to protect the new lock in place.Test for Functionality: Ensure that the lock engages smoothly and firmly.3. Fixing Sticking Doors
Tools Needed: Soft cloth, lube (silicone spray)

Steps:
Clean the Track: Wipe down the track with a soft cloth to eliminate debris.Oil the Track: Apply silicone spray to minimize friction. Avoid using oil, as it attracts dirt.Check the Door: Open and close the door to make sure smooth operation.4. Weatherstripping Replacement
Tools Needed: Tape step, energy knife, adhesive weatherstripping

Actions:
Remove Old Weatherstripping: Carefully peel away the old weatherstripping.Measure and Cut New Stripping: Measure the lengths needed and cut the new weatherstripping to size.Install New Weatherstripping: Press the adhesive weatherstripping into place along the door frame.5. Repairing Glass Damage
Tools Needed: Safety goggles, gloves, glass repair package or replacement glass

Actions:
Assess the Damage: Determine whether a repair set will be adequate or if a complete replacement is needed.Eliminate Broken Glass: For safety, wear gloves and goggles while thoroughly removing shattered pieces.Set Up New Glass Patio Door Replacement: Follow the guidelines supplied with the repair set or consult an expert for complete replacement.When to Call a Professional

How typically should I preserve my patio doors?
Routine maintenance must occur at least twice a year, including cleansing tracks, oiling rollers, and inspecting for wear and tear.
2. Can I repair my patio door myself?
Most common repair work can be performed by house owners with standard tools and skills. Nevertheless, more complicated concerns might require expert aid.
3. How do I know if my door requires to be changed?
Indications include comprehensive damage to the frame, persistent problems despite repair work, or absence of functionality that impacts security and energy performance.
4. What is the average cost for patio door repair work?
Costs can vary widely based on the type of repair and location but normally range from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500 for minor concerns. For substantial repair work, costs might exceed ₤ 1,000.
5. How can I prevent future problems with my patio door?
Routine maintenance, such as cleaning, lubrication, and examinations, can assist prevent future issues, keeping the door operating efficiently for several years to come.
